- How to Create an Effective Blogging Strategy
A successful blog doesn’t happen by chance. It requires clear goals, consistent effort, and strategic planning. Here’s how to build a blog that drives measurable business growth.
Step 1: Define Your Objectives
Before writing, clarify your goals. Are you aiming to:
– Increase website traffic?
– Generate qualified leads?
– Educate your audience?
– Boost brand awareness?
Your goals will shape the type of content you create and the metrics you track.
Step 2: Know Your Target Audience
Understand who your readers are, including their needs, challenges, and interests. Create buyer personas to customize your content to their preferences. The more relevant your content, the higher the engagement.
Step 3: Conduct Keyword Research
Keyword research helps identify the topics your audience is searching for. T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, or SEMrush can help you find relevant keywords with high search volume and low competition. Focus on long-tail keywords that reflect specific intent, such as “best CRM tools for small businesses” instead of just “CRM.”
Step 4: Create a Content Calendar
Consistency is essential. Develop a monthly or quarterly content calendar that lays out topics, publishing dates, and responsible team members. This ensures regular posting and balanced topic coverage.
Step 5: Produce High-Quality, Valuable Content
Your content should educate, entertain, or inspire readers. Aim for well-researched, original, and actionable articles. Include visuals like images, infographics, and videos to make your posts more engaging. Always prioritize quality over quantity.
Step 6: Optimize for SEO
Naturally incorporate keywords in titles, meta descriptions, headings, and throughout your post. Use internal links to connect related articles and external links to reputable sources. Optimize images and ensure your website loads quickly.
Step 7: Promote Your Blog
Publishing a post is just the start. Share it across social media, email newsletters, and online communities. You can also partner with influencers or industry colleagues to broaden your reach.
Step 8: Analyze and Refine
Track key performance indicators (KPIs) like:
– Page views
– Average time on page
– Bounce rate
– Lead conversions
– Social shares
Use analytics tools like Google Analytics or HubSpot to assess your progress and improve your strategy over time.
- Types of Blog Content That Drive Business Growth
Not all blog content performs the same. Here are types of posts that usually lead to the best results for businesses:
– How-To Guides & Tutorials – Teach your audience practical skills or solutions.
– Case Studies – Showcase real-life success stories to build credibility.
– Listicles – Provide easy-to-scan, actionable insights (e.g., “10 Ways to Improve Customer Retention”).
– Industry Insights & Trends – Share updates and forecasts to position your brand as an expert.
– Product Comparisons & Reviews – Help readers make informed purchasing choices.
– Customer Stories or Interviews – Humanize your brand by featuring real people.
- Common Blogging Mistakes to Avoid
While blogging offers great potential, many businesses make mistakes that limit success. Avoid these missteps:
– Publishing Irregularly – Inconsistency can make your audience lose interest.
– Overly Promotional Content – Aim to provide value, not just push sales.
– Ignoring SEO – Even great content won’t perform well without optimization.
– Neglecting Visuals and Formatting – Large text blocks can turn readers away.
– Not Tracking Results – Without analytics, it’s hard to measure improvement.
